Re: Brakes - Slotted, Drilled or both? Thu, 13 May 2004 22:54 Go to previous messageGo to previous message
A good quality slotted disc is best as the material also has a big effect on braking capability and longevity.

To see what is the best for hard track work, just look at what the V8SC circus runs. They are all slotted, and the reason why drilled discs crack is the heat cycle stresses and the fact that the holes are stress concentration points and therefore help start the cracks. Once they start, it isn't long before a disc is toast.

The drilled discs are for 90% looks, and the slots are best for any hard work as it helps clean the pad surface and allow the escape of gasses built up on the pad surface during braking
